Why Camping Lights Are Non-Negotiable for Outdoor Trips

Camping is all about embracing nature, but that doesn’t mean you have to sacrifice comfort or safety after dark. Here’s why a dedicated camping light should be at the top of your packing list:

  • Safety First: Dark trails, uneven terrain, and unexpected obstacles pose risks without proper illumination. A bright, portable light helps you avoid trips, falls, or encounters with wildlife.

  • Functionality: From chopping firewood and setting up a tent to reading a book or cooking meals, tasks that are easy in daylight become frustrating (or even dangerous) in the dark.

  • Atmosphere: String lights draped over your tent or a warm-glow lantern on the picnic table turn a basic campsite into a welcoming retreat. Lighting sets the mood for relaxation and connection.

  • Emergency Preparedness: If a storm hits or you need to signal for help, a durable camping light with long battery life can be a lifesaver.

Unlike regular flashlights, camping lights are designed for extended use, broader illumination, and outdoor durability—making them a must-have for every camper, whether you’re a weekend car camper or a backcountry adventurer.

What to Look for in a High-Quality Camping Light

Not all camping lights are created equal. To find one that lasts and meets your needs, keep these key features in mind:

1. Light Output & Color Temperature

  • Lumens: For general campsite lighting (like lanterns), 100–300 lumens is ideal—bright enough to light a small area without being harsh. For task lighting (e.g., cooking), look for 300–500 lumens.

  • Color Temperature: Warm white (2700K–3000K) mimics candlelight, creating a cozy vibe and preserving night vision. Cool white (5000K–6500K) is better for tasks that require clarity, like reading maps.

2. Battery Life & Power Options

  • Long Runtime: Aim for at least 8–10 hours of use on low brightness (for overnight trips) and 2–4 hours on high.

  • Versatile Charging: Rechargeable lights (via USB-C or solar) are eco-friendly and cost-effective, but models that accept disposable batteries (like AA/AAA) are great for backup in remote areas.

3. Durability & Weather Resistance

  • Waterproof Rating: Look for an IPX4 rating (splash-resistant) or higher—critical for unexpected rain or damp conditions.

  • Rugged Build: Lights made from durable plastic or aluminum can withstand drops, bumps, and rough handling.

4. Portability & Design

  • Compact & Lightweight: For backpackers, a lantern that weighs under 1 pound and folds flat is essential. Car campers can opt for larger, decorative options like string lights.

  • Hands-Free Use: Features like hanging hooks, magnetic bases, or clip-on designs let you position the light where you need it—freeing up your hands for cooking or setup.

5. Special Modes

  • Dimming: Adjust brightness to conserve battery or set the mood.

  • SOS/Strobe: Useful for emergencies or signaling other campers.

  • Red Light Mode: Preserves night vision (perfect for stargazing or early-morning hikes without blinding yourself).
